Xeriscape Landscaping in Ventura County, CA

Xeriscape landscaping services focus on creating drought-tolerant outdoor spaces that require minimal water and maintenance. These projects typically include designing and installing landscapes with native and adapted plants, rock or mulch ground covers, and efficient irrigation systems. Property owners often seek xeriscaping to reduce water bills, promote sustainable outdoor environments, or enhance curb appeal while minimizing upkeep. Before requesting xeriscape services, homeowners should consider the existing soil conditions, the local climate, and their desired level of maintenance to ensure the landscape plan aligns with their needs and expectations.

Understanding the scope of xeriscape projects is essential for property owners considering this approach. Common requests include replacing traditional lawns with low-water alternatives, establishing xeric plant beds, and integrating decorative elements like stone pathways or drought-resistant shrubs. It’s helpful to clarify the types of plants preferred, the level of ongoing care desired, and any specific aesthetic goals. Having a clear idea of the property's water restrictions and soil conditions can also support the planning process, ensuring the landscape design is both practical and sustainable for the local environment.

Project Types

Common Xeriscape Landscaping Jobs

Design Consultation - guidance on selecting drought-tolerant plants and efficient landscape layouts.

Plant Selection and Installation - installing native and low-water plants suited for the local climate.

Soil Preparation - improving soil conditions to support healthy, water-efficient landscaping.

Mulching Services - applying mulch to reduce evaporation and suppress weeds.

Irrigation System Setup - installing efficient drip or low-flow watering systems for minimal water use.

Landscape Maintenance - ongoing care to ensure xeriscape features remain healthy and attractive.

FAQ

Xeriscape Landscaping Questions

What is Xeriscape landscaping? Xeriscape landscaping involves designing outdoor spaces with drought-tolerant plants and efficient irrigation to reduce water use while maintaining visual appeal.

What types of plants are used in Xeriscaping? Native and adapted plants that require minimal water, such as succulents, ornamental grasses, and drought-resistant shrubs, are commonly used.

Is Xeriscaping suitable for all property types? Yes, Xeriscaping can be tailored to various property sizes and styles, making it a flexible choice for many homeowners and property owners.

What are the benefits of Xeriscape landscaping? It reduces water consumption, lowers maintenance needs, and creates a sustainable, attractive outdoor environment.
